Abstract

529,534. Exchange systems. SIEMENS BROS. & CO., Ltd., LONG, D. P., and HUMPHRIES, H. E. June 2,1939, No. 16270. [Class 40 (iv)] The device shown is connected by an access switch (not shown) to busy junctions and tests them for the presence of steady (tone) or interrupted (speech) voice-frequency current and may apply a releasing tone current to a faultily-held junction, When the test is started ST is operated and if the access switch is on an idle line the operation of FT shortly afterwards causes the stepping on of the access switch and the release of ST. When a busy junction is encountered, however, TA comes up and ET completes the circuit of a slow-tooperate relay TB. TA also connects the junction to the input circuit of a valve V<SP>1</SP> the biassing arrangements of which are such that the output is substantially constant for different values of input. The resulting currents are rectified at MR and fed to a D.C. amplifier V2 with a relay S in its plate circuit. The sensitiveness of the arrangement is adjusted in accordance with noise conditions by a biassing and reverse reaction resistance YC associated with V1 and a biassing resistance YB associated with V2. If the junction is silent S remains inert and when TB comes up W is energized and connects a resistance YH to a time-measuring apparatus (not shown) to cause it to measure a period of from one to three minutes. At the end of this period a circuit is made over contacts a, e of the device for AR which locks, lights a lamp and gives an alarm. If the junction is in use S responds intermittently to the speech currents and, after energizing Z or W on the operation of TB, energizes Y or X on changing over and subsequently the other relays of this group whereupon TA is released followed by TB and W ... Z and the access switch moves on. If the junction carries a steady tone, S is energized steadily and Z only is operated. After an interval, which in this case is from 15 to 60 seconds owing to the connection of resistance YK instead of YH to the time-measuring apparatus, a circuit is made for the alarm relay AR which lights a lamp L2. If the key RCK is thrown and the junction is silent relay P is operated over interrupter contacts tp, which close for an instant every six seconds, after the closure of the delay device contacts a, e and locks in series with Q which connects steady tone from RT to the junction and arranges for the temporary operation of R on the next closure of contacts tp to cause the release of P, and the removal of the tone. If the releasing signal is effective TA falls and releases TB. If not the next closure of tp energizes alarm relay AR to give a signal. During testing the balancing circuit of the junction circuit is modified by connection of YE or YF according as the detecting set or the tone source . is connected up.
